Lot 28

A long 14 bore brass barrelled flintlock holster pistol by Knubley, c 1790, 18” overall, heavy octagonal barrel 12” with beaded band at the breech, engraved “Knubley-Charing Cross - London”, and with steel floral engraved break off breech with rearsight; flat signed stepped brass lock with safety bolt, semi rainproof pan, and large roller on frizzen spring; plain walnut fullstock with shell carved apron around the breech tang, and with pale brass mounts comprising long spurred butt cap, trophy engraved trigger guard with pineapple finial, and plain ramrod pipes. Good Working Order and Condition (cock and ramrod replaced). Plate 8

Lot 368

Original vintage movie poster for the 1973 American coming-of-age comedy film American Grafitti directed and co-written by George Lucas and produced by Francis Ford Coppola. Starring Richard Dreyfuss, Ron Howard, Paul Le Mat, Harrison Ford, Charles Martin Smith, Cindy Williams, Candy Clark, Mackenzie Phillips, Bo Hopkins, and Wolfman Jack, the film was the launchpad for many mainstream actors and directors. Set in Modesto, California, in 1962, the film is a study of the cruising and early rock 'n' roll cultures popular among the early baby boomer generation and received widespread critical acclaim as well as being nominated for the Academy Award for Best Picture and Best Director. Produced on a small budget, it has become one of the most profitable films of all time and had a soundtrack that would be a staple in rollerskating rinks around the country for years to come.The poster features a great design by David Willardson, most known for his work with Disney characters, showing a glamourous waitress on roller-skates standing in front of a diner with the black and white image design set against a vivid orange sky. Condition: Very good condition, fold in centre, minor creasing.. Country of printing: France, designer: David Willardson, size (cm): 53x40, year of printing: 1973.
